+[WLUG]'s MailingList is one of the primary methods of communication between members. It is (barely) moderated, has very low to moderate traffic, and exists to help the [LUG] members keep in touch, get organised, and offer help to anyone who has a [Linux]-related problem. We have [list archives | http://list.waikato.ac.nz/pipermail/wlug] too. 
  
 __Note:__ you ''must'' be subscribed to the list to be able to post to the list. __Any message sent from an unsubscribed address will be automatically discarded!__

 !! History 
  
-Our first post is lost to us due to the list running originally on a manky ExchangeServer , and GreigMcGill not keeping archives. However, [the first post to the first "real" list | http://list.waikato.ac.nz/pipermail/wlug/1999-March/009603.html] dates back to March '99, which puts the origins of [WLUG] at (very approximately) six months earlier.
